To the release manager: I'm passing ownership of the Pellwick deep-link router to Sorrel before the 4.2 cut. The intent-matching table now lives in the Farrowgate config service; stale entries were purged last sprint. Watch the fallback route — it silently swallows malformed slugs, which inflated our drop-off metrics in March. The staging resolver needs its keystore unlocked before each regression pass, and that keystore accepts only one credential. For the signing vault, the recovery phrase is noted directly below.

recovery phrase for tafog-fafog: novix-novdor-fraath-brieth-olieth-oliix-rusix-wenion-julax-druox

# Client setup for the Wrenfield replica-lag alarm.
# This client polls the Saltmere metrics service every 30 seconds and
# raises a page if replica lag on the reporting cluster exceeds the
# threshold set in alarm_config. Release managers: do not deploy while
# an alarm is active, as cutover scripts assume fresh replicas.
# The client authenticates to Saltmere with the internal key below.

service key, fawip-bajef: kto11_Qt5wZK9vdNC

Handover — Vexler partner SFTP drop

Ownership moves to you today. Drop runs hourly from Vexler's end into the intake bucket via the relay host. Watch for zero-byte files; their exporter flakes on Mondays. Creds live in the ops vault, path noted in the runbook. Vault auto-seals after 48h idle. Support escalations go to the on-call rotation, not me. If the vault is sealed when you need it, unseal with the recovery passphrase below.

recovery phrase for tadug-fafof: zorwyn-kasion